Salary Information & Job Trends In this Region
History / Social Studies Teachers in Hinds, Mississippi play a crucial role in educating students about the past and preparing them for informed citizenship. - Entry-level History Teacher salaries range from $36,000 to $42,000 per year - Mid-career Social Studies Teacher salaries range from $42,000 to $58,000 per year - Senior History Department Head salaries range from $58,000 to $75,000 per year The role of a History / Social Studies Teacher in Hinds, Mississippi has been an integral part of the educational landscape, tasked with the responsibility of imparting knowledge of historical facts and social concepts.
